Speaking of the match, Sri Lanka batted first and scored 262 for 9 in 50 overs. Chamika Karunaratne scored the most runs for Sri Lanka. Captain Dasun Shanaka scored 39 runs. Team India’s Deepak Chahar, Yuzvendra Chahal and Kuldeep Yadav took two wickets each. Yuvvendra Chahal and Kuldeep Yadav once again played together in this match for India. Two years ago, the two played together for the last time at the 2019 ODI World Cup.

Ishan Kishan and Suryakumar Yadav have made their ODI debut for India. Ishaan Kishan is the second Indian cricketer to make his ODI debut on his birthday. Gursharan Singh, an Indian cricketer who debuted on his birthday before Kishan. He played his first and last ODI against Australia at Hamilton on March 8, 1990. Sri Lanka captain Dasun Shanaka won the toss and elected to bat. Bhanuka Rajapaksa made his debut for Sri Lanka.
